For licensed/registered massage therapists
Manual lymphatic drainage (MLD) is an effective and gentle manual technique that is easy on the therapist’s body and well tolerated by even the most sensitive patients. MLD reduces swelling and detoxifies the skin and superficial fascia by promoting drainage within superficial and deep systems in the lymph-vascular network.
This 5½-day course is based on the technique developed by Dr. Emil Vodder and focuses on both theoretical and hands-on application.
Students will learn the anatomy and physiology of the lymphatic system, as well as effective MLD sequences that can reduce swelling and other symptoms associated with postsurgical edema, soft-tissue injuries, rheumatoid arthritis, fibromyalgia, whiplash, migraine headaches, PTSD, anxiety disorders, and lymphedema.
